   Hi Tim,   
      
   On 2022-03-10 23:01:40, you wrote to Michiel van der Vlist:   
      
    TS> Well, as long as I have no indication that the result order of the OS   
    TS> returned has any semantics at all (rather than beeing random) relying   
    TS> on itmay worse than making an enducated guess. If you know some place   
    TS> that defines that the order is actually a suggestion on priorities   
    TS> that would be fine.   
      
   It took some google-ing, but I got your answer.   
      
   There is an extensive RFC written about this subject:   
      
   https://www.ietf.org/rfc/rfc3484.txt   
   (See paragraph 10.3 if you are in a hurry ;-))   
      
   Windows implements this RFC:   
      
   https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/troubleshoot/windows-server/net   
   orking/configure-ipv6-in-windows   
      
   Bye, Wilfred.
